Форум Beholder http://beholder.ru/bb/ | |
Немогу настроить пульт Beholder 609 FM в Ubuntu 9.10 http://beholder.ru/bb/viewtopic.php?f=11&t=8999 |
Страница 1 из 1 |
Автор: | mantana [ 01 фев 2010, 09:39 ] |
Заголовок сообщения: | Немогу настроить пульт Beholder 609 FM в Ubuntu 9.10 |
Добрый день уважаемые господа! Уже 2 дня бьюсь над данным тюнером под управлением Ubuntu 9.10. Никак немогу завести пульт.Выкладываю конфиги скажите где неправильно сделал: Цитата: # /etc/lirc/hardware.conf # # Arguments which will be used when launching lircd LIRCD_ARGS="" #Don't start lircmd even if there seems to be a good config file #START_LIRCMD=false #Don't start irexec, even if a good config file seems to exist. #START_IREXEC=false #Try to load appropriate kernel modules LOAD_MODULES=false # Run "lircd --driver=help" for a list of supported drivers. DRIVER="dev/input" # If DEVICE is set to /dev/lirc and udev is in use /dev/lirc0 will be # automatically used instead DEVICE="/dev/input/event5" MODULES="" # Default configuration files for your hardware if any LIRCD_CONF="" LIRCMD_CONF="" Цитата: # lircd.conf # Remote Control Beholder TV config file begin remote name RC_BeholderTV bits 16 eps 30 aeps 100 one 0 0 zero 0 0 pre_data_bits 16 pre_data 0x8001 gap 132995 toggle_bit_mask 0x80010000 begin codes 0 0x000B 1 0x0002 2 0x0003 3 0x0004 4 0x0005 5 0x0006 6 0x0007 7 0x0008 8 0x0009 9 0x000A CHANNELDOWN 0x0193 CHANNELUP 0x0192 RECALL 0x0081 TV_FM 0x0182 MODE 0x0175 FULLSCREEN 0x0174 ASPECT 0x0177 INFO 0x0166 RECORD 0x00A7 PLAYPAUSE 0x00A4 STOP 0x0080 TELETEXT 0x0184 RED 0x018E GREEN 0x018F YELLOW 0x0190 BLUE 0x0191 SLEEP 0x008E FREEZE 0x00EA SNAPSHOT 0x0199 OK 0x0160 VOLUMEUP 0x0073 VOLUMEDOWN 0x0072 MUTE 0x0071 POWER 0x0074 end codes end remote Цитата: # .lircrc #UNCONFIGURED # # To find out how to get a proper configuration file please read: # # /usr/share/doc/lirc/README.Debian begin prog=irexec button=POWER config=tvtime & config=tvtime-command QUIT repeat=0 end begin prog=irexec button=ZOOM config=tvtime-command TOGGLE_FULLSCREEN repeat=0 end begin prog=irexec button=1 config=tvtime-command CHANNEL_1 repeat=0 end begin prog=irexec button=2 config=tvtime-command CHANNEL_2 repeat=0 end begin prog=irexec button=3 config=tvtime-command CHANNEL_3 repeat=0 end begin prog=irexec button=4 config=tvtime-command CHANNEL_4 repeat=0 end begin prog=irexec button=5 config=tvtime-command CHANNEL_5 repeat=0 end begin prog=irexec button=6 config=tvtime-command CHANNEL_6 repeat=0 end begin prog=irexec button=7 config=tvtime-command CHANNEL_7 repeat=0 end begin prog=irexec button=8 config=tvtime-command CHANNEL_8 repeat=0 end begin prog=irexec button=9 config=tvtime-command CHANNEL_9 repeat=0 end begin prog=irexec button=0 config=tvtime-command CHANNEL_0 repeat=0 end begin prog=irexec button=ASPECT config=tvtime-command TOGGLE_ASPECT repeat=0 end begin prog=irexec button=INFO config=tvtime-command DISPLAY_INFO repeat=0 end begin prog=irexec button=SLEEP config=tvtime-command TOGGLE_PAUSE repeat=0 end begin prog=irexec button=MUTE config=tvtime-command TOGGLE_MUTE repeat=0 end begin prog=irexec button=VOLUMEUP config=tvtime-command RIGHT repeat=1 end begin prog=irexec button=VOLUMEDOWN config=tvtime-command LEFT repeat=1 end begin prog=irexec button=CHANNELUP config=tvtime-command UP repeat=0 end begin prog=irexec button=CHANNELDOWN config=tvtime-command DOWN repeat=0 end begin prog=irexec button=SNAPSHOT config=tvtime-command SCREENSHOT repeat=0 end begin prog=irexec button=SOURCE config=tvtime-command TOGGLE_INPUT repeat=0 end begin prog=irexec button=VOLUMEUP config=tvtime-command RIGHT repeat=1 end begin prog=irexec button=VOLUMEDOWN config=tvtime-command LEFT repeat=1 end Вот инфа о эвентах: Цитата: I: Bus=0019 Vendor=0000 Product=0001 Version=0000 N: Name="Power Button" P: Phys=LNXPWRBN/button/input0 S: Sysfs=/devices/LNXSYSTM:00/LNXPWRBN:00/input/input0 U: Uniq= H: Handlers=kbd event0 B: EV=3 B: KEY=100000 0 0 0 I: Bus=0019 Vendor=0000 Product=0001 Version=0000 N: Name="Power Button" P: Phys=PNP0C0C/button/input0 S: Sysfs=/devices/LNXSYSTM:00/device:00/PNP0C0C:00/input/input1 U: Uniq= H: Handlers=kbd event1 B: EV=3 B: KEY=100000 0 0 0 I: Bus=0017 Vendor=0001 Product=0001 Version=0100 N: Name="Macintosh mouse button emulation" P: Phys= S: Sysfs=/devices/virtual/input/input2 U: Uniq= H: Handlers=mouse0 event2 B: EV=7 B: KEY=70000 0 0 0 0 0 0 0 0 B: REL=3 I: Bus=0011 Vendor=0001 Product=0001 Version=ab41 N: Name="AT Translated Set 2 keyboard" P: Phys=isa0060/serio0/input0 S: Sysfs=/devices/platform/i8042/serio0/input/input3 U: Uniq= H: Handlers=kbd event3 B: EV=120013 B: KEY=4 2000000 3803078 f800d001 feffffdf ffefffff ffffffff fffffffe B: MSC=10 B: LED=7 I: Bus=0001 Vendor=10ec Product=0662 Version=0001 N: Name="HDA Digital PCBeep" P: Phys=card0/codec#0/beep0 S: Sysfs=/devices/pci0000:00/0000:00:1b.0/input/input4 U: Uniq= H: Handlers=kbd event4 B: EV=40001 B: SND=6 I: Bus=0018 Vendor=0000 Product=0000 Version=0000 N: Name="i2c IR (BeholdTV)" P: Phys=i2c-1/1-002d/ir0 S: Sysfs=/devices/virtual/input/input5 U: Uniq= H: Handlers=kbd event5 B: EV=100003 B: KEY=20fc014 b00041 0 0 0 400 0 90 4003 1e0000 0 0 ffc I: Bus=0011 Vendor=0002 Product=0006 Version=0000 N: Name="ImExPS/2 Generic Explorer Mouse" P: Phys=isa0060/serio1/input0 S: Sysfs=/devices/platform/i8042/serio1/input/input6 U: Uniq= H: Handlers=mouse1 event6 B: EV=7 B: KEY=1f0000 0 0 0 0 0 0 0 0 B: REL=143 Непойму что нитак. система на пульт реагирует, цифры в TVTIME срабатывают. Делаю все по инструкции, перелапатил всю ветку линукса на форуме. Вот как реагирует пульт в терминале: Цитата: input-events $(lsinput |grep -B 5 "BeholdTV" | grep "event" | sed 's#.*event##') /dev/input/event5 bustype : BUS_I2C vendor : 0x0 product : 0x0 version : 0 name : "i2c IR (BeholdTV)" phys : "i2c-1/1-002d/ir0" bits ev : EV_SYN EV_KEY EV_REP waiting for events 11:38:01.938474: EV_KEY KEY_CHANNELUP (0x192) pressed 11:38:01.938486: EV_SYN code=0 value=0 11:38:02.146475: EV_KEY KEY_CHANNELUP (0x192) released 11:38:02.146486: EV_SYN code=0 value=0 11:38:03.354914: EV_KEY KEY_CHANNELDOWN (0x193) pressed 11:38:03.354934: EV_SYN code=0 value=0 11:38:03.562464: EV_KEY KEY_CHANNELDOWN (0x193) released 11:38:03.562478: EV_SYN code=0 value=0 Вот как реагирует система на перизапуск лирка: Цитата: sudo /etc/init.d/lirc restart * Stopping remote control daemon(s): LIRC [fail] * Starting remote control daemon(s) : LIRC [fail] Просто боюсь убить систему вот и отписался, я перипробывал очень много вариантов описанных на данном форуме P.S. После того как попробовал сделать так, пульт отвалился и перестал реагировать: Цитата: 1 в synaptic удалил полностью lirc.
2 открыл в главном меню внизу установку/удаление приложений и установил lirc от туда. 3 при появлении меню с выбором железа в верхнем меню выбрал Linux dev input (или как то так) а в нижнем установил custom. 4 далее появилось еще одно меню в котором я выбрал /dev/input/event5 5 Рестартнул lirc командой: sudo /etc/init.d/lirc restart 6 запустил irexec командой: irexec -d 7 запустил tvtime и он не стал управляться от пульта. Заранее благодарю ![]() |
Автор: | Linux [ 02 фев 2010, 06:34 ] |
Заголовок сообщения: | |
По какой-то причине Lirc не стартует. Почитайте Otto и ниже. http://www.beholder.ru/bb/viewtopic.php?p=55493#55493 |
Страница 1 из 1 | Часовой пояс: UTC + 3 часа |